BERTOLLI Tomato Florentine And Tortellini With… vs. BERTOLLI Tortellini Margherita, 10 OZ
Side-by-side comparison of nutrient values per 100g edible portion, sourced directly from the U.S. Department of Agriculture's FoodData Central (FDC) - SR Legacy reference foods and FDC Foundation foods (April 2026 release). Each value reflects USDA's standardized laboratory analysis methodology under USDA data-documentation methodology.
BERTOLLI Tomato Florentine And Tortellini With… has the most protein of the foods compared, at 6.5 g per 100g.
| Nutrient | BERTOLLI Tomato Florentine And… | BERTOLLI Tortellini Margherita, 10 OZ |
|---|---|---|
| Protein | 6.5 G | 5.7 G |
| Total lipid (fat) | 5.6 G | 4.6 G |
| Carbohydrate, by difference | 12.1 G | 17 G |
| Energy | 124 KCAL | - |
| Total Sugars | 3.8 G | 3.5 G |
| Fiber, total dietary | 2.4 G | 2.1 G |
| Calcium, Ca | 59 MG | 106 MG |
| Iron, Fe | 0.79 MG | 0.64 MG |
| Potassium, K | 265 MG | 173 MG |
| Sodium, Na | 447 MG | 367 MG |
| Cholesterol | 25 MG | 12 MG |
| Fatty acids, total trans | 0.15 G | 0 G |
| Fatty acids, total saturated | 2.9 G | 2.1 G |
